Summary

H-1B LCA filings for Bill Com span 2016 Q2 to 2023 Q3, peaking at 63 filings in 2023 Q2.

The most recent reported period (2023 Q3) shows 30 filings.

LCA filings are labor-condition applications certified by the U.S. Department of Labor, not active job postings or approved USCIS H-1B petitions.
